What companies run services between Tallinn, Estonia and Naantali, Finland?
FlixBus operates a bus from Tallinn Harbour to Turku, Bus Station once daily. Tickets cost €20–35 and the journey takes 5h 10m. Alternatively, Air Baltic, Scandinavian Airlines, and two other airlines fly from Lennart Meri International Airport (TLL) to Turku Airport (TKU) 3 times a day.
